We'd prefer not to carry the weight for our whole drive. Is it realistic to wait until Reno to buy 100 gallons of water at a grocery store or stores? Or do we just have to accept the gas mileage hit of lugging it the whole way?

Almost all of the grocery stores in the area will be stocking extra supplies for the playa-bound. Raleys at N McCarran & Pyramid has an entire aisle set aside with water, charcoal, a few cheap grills, etc.

But, just remember that there are 40,000 other people headed there that may have the same plan as you do, so while stores are stocking up, supplies tend to dwindle rather rapidly, especially water.

Your best bet will always be having a rock solid plan for securing whatever supplies are not in your vehicle when you leave for the playa. Yes, you will probably be able to find what you need somewhere in Reno, but it might take trips to several different stores, which can be frustrating, and only cuts into your time on the playa!
